body {
  margin: 0 auto;
  padding: 10px;
  color: black;
  background: white;
  font-family: sans-serif;
  font-size: large;
}

table{
  border-collapse: collapse;
}
td {
  border: 2px white solid;
  padding: 0.5em;
}
td.label {
  background: lightgrey;
}

ul.files {
  margin: 0;
}
li.file {
  list-style-type: "💾 ";
}
li.folder {
  list-style-type: "📁 ";
}

@media (min-width: 800px) {
  body { width: 780px; }
}
